Expression diagrams beds in the area of formal verification. The implementation of the logical gates are performed by the rules of the boolean algebra, and based on the combinations of the operations or, and and not. The map shows that the expression cannot be simplified. In this project series of switches have been used as keypad, is used to give the input minterms expression. Boolean algebra, a logic algebra, allows the rules used in the algebra of numbers to be applied to logic.
Enter a boolean expression such as a b v c in the box and click parse. Circuit diagram of boolean algebra calculator electronicshub. B the gate only gives output when both the switches a and b are closed. The microcontroller plays a major role in this project which is coded with this algorithm and controls the other components used in the circuit. Laws and rules of boolean algebra continued laws of boolean algebra continued. The logic calculator is an application useful to perform logical operations.
In this mode we have the basic boolean operations negation, conjunction, disjunction, conditional and biconditional so the user can insert the logic formula and the logic calculator displays the truth table along with the models of the formula. This boolean algebra calculator is an interesting project which is more useful in our real life by working as a portable calculator to simplify the boolean expression on the fly. States that a boolean equation remains valid if we take the dual of the expressions on both sides of the equals sign. When proving any property of an abstract boolean algebra, we may only use the axioms and previously proven results. It uses the quine mccluskey algorithm which was described in the chapter 1. Boolean algebra is a type of algebra that is used in the design of digital logic circuitry, computer programs such as search engines and in general in analytic reasoning. Specify the number of variables of your boolean function. Huntington and axiomatization, janet barnett author. Boolean logic calculator online boole algebra simplifier tool.
It is also called as binary algebra or logical algebra. Boolean algebra calculator circuit working and applications. Boolean algebra is used to analyze and simplify the digital logic circuits. Pdf a simple and efficient boolean solver for constraint logic. The simplification of boolean equations can use different methods. Mar 08, 2017 with the just two states, on and off, the flow of electricity can be used to perform a number of logical operations, which are guided by a branch of mathematics called boolean algebra. Truth table solver is a program that solves the truth table and output all the possible minimized boolean expressions. Boolean algebra calculator circuit and working principle. This is a portable device which can simplify a boolean expression. Byjus online boolean algebra calculator tool makes the conversion faster, and it displays the output in a fraction of seconds. Function evaluationbasic identities duality principle.
The karnaugh map provides a method for simplifying boolean expressions it will produce the simplest sop and pos expressions works best for less than 6 variables similar to a truth table it maps all possibilities a karnaugh map is an array of cells arranged in a special manner the number of cells is 2n where n number of variables a 3variable karnaugh map. Propositions will be denoted by upper case roman letters, such as a or b, etc. You can enter your boolean function in either its truth table, or its algebraic normal formanf or its trace representation. This chapter contains a brief introduction the basics of logic design. The twovalued boolean algebra has important application in the design of modern computing systems. Find more computational sciences widgets in wolframalpha. In our circuit, we use boolean algebra simplification methods like the quinemccluskey algorithm to simplify the boolean expression and display the output on the display.
Math 123 boolean algebra chapter 11 boolean algebra. Because they are allowed to possess only one of two possible values, either 1 or 0, each and every variable has a complement. Aug 15, 2015 in our circuit, we use boolean algebra simplification methods like the quinemccluskey algorithm to simplify the boolean expression and display the output on the display. The boolean calculators are free to use and are the most compatible with any computer compared to a regular calculator. Since the logic levels are generally associated with the symbols 1 and 0, whatever letters are used as variables that can. Boolean variables boolean variables are associated with the binary number system and are useful in the development of equations to determine an outcome based on the occurrence of events. Step 3 write a boolean expression with a term for each 1 output row of the table. Lets begin with a semiconductor gate circuit in need of simplification.
Yonsei university outline set, relations, and functions partial orders boolean functions don t care conditions incomplete specifications. Each digit on the keypad corresponds to one minterm each. In mathematics and mathematical logic, boolean algebra is the branch of algebra in which the. Boolean algebra is the category of algebra in which the variables values are the truth values, true and false, ordinarily denoted 1 and 0 respectively. In particular, we may not assume we are working in any one particular example of a boolean algebra, such as the boolean algebra 0,1. Boolean algebra introduction boolean algebra is the algebra of propositions.
Rule in boolean algebra following are the important rules used in boolean algebra. Mini projects in electronics and communication engineering. Following are the important rules used in boolean algebra. Boolean algebra, 4variable expression simplification. This circuit is a simple 3 variable boolean expression minimizer. When the twoelement boolean algebra is used, the boolean matrix is called a logical matrix. In some contexts, particularly computer science, the term boolean matrix implies this restriction. Toolcalculator to simplify or minify boolean expressions boolean algebra containing logical expressions with and, or, not, xor. Boolean algebra calculator circuit with its working and. Postulate 5 defines an operator called complement that is not available in ordinary algebra.
It has been fundamental in the development of digital electronics and is provided. The following pages are intended to give you a solid foundation in working with boolean algebra. Yonsei university boolean algebra computer action team. Boolean algebra calculator is a free online tool that displays the truth table, logic circuit and venn diagram for the given input.
In this circuit, we use boolean algebra simplification. The simplified and gate shown above has two inputs, switch a and b. Supported operations are and, or, not, xor, implies, provided and equiv. Goodstein was also well known as a distinguished educator.
T when the proposition is true and f when the proposition is false. I was just introduced to boolean algebra and only have basic identities at my disposal. This calculator solves the boolean expressions and logic functions by using different theorems and laws. Boolean algebra and other binary systems, this algebra was called binary logic.
Boolean algebra is also sometimes referred to as boolean logic or just logic. Here you can check the properties of your boolean function. Boolean algebra deals with the as yet undefined set of elements, b, in twovalued. Boolean algebra is a logical algebra in which symbols are used to represent logic levels. It works as a portable calculator to simplify the boolean expression on the fly. Boolean algebra was designed by the british mathematician george boole 1815 1864. Boolean algebra doesnt have additive and multiplicative inverses. The goal is to have a simple calculator that takes a boolean expression and returns a truth table in a large number of languages, written by many people. Logic, boolean algebra, and digital circuits jim emery edition 4292012 contents 1 introduction 4 2 related documents 5 3 a comment on notation 5 4 a note on elementary electronics 7 5booleanalgebra 8 6 logic operators and truth tables 8 7 a list of logic identities and properties 9 7. The microcontroller used in this project plays a vital. Boolean algebra calculator works as a portable calculator to simplify the boolean expression on the fly. Sep 26, 20 simplification of boolean functions using the theorems of boolean algebra, the algebraic forms of functions can often be simplified, which leads to simpler and cheaper implementations. It reduces the original expression to an equivalent expression that has fewer terms which means that.
Boolean algebra calculator simplifies the logic functions and boolean expressions by using the laws and theorems that are implemented on this algorithm. Boolean algebra design projects for each problem, a specify the input and output variables and the two states of each. On the diagrammatic and mechanical representation of propositions and reasonings pdf. In mathematics, a boolean matrix is a matrix with entries from a boolean algebra. The microcontroller used in this project plays a vital role. Tool calculator to simplify or minify boolean expressions boolean algebra containing logical expressions with and, or, not, xor.
Boolean algebra calculator circuit with applications elprocus. Creating a simple boolean logic calculator in c physics forums. The bulb q will only light if both switches are closed. The boolean algebra calculator uses the basic laws like identity law. Boolean algebra calculator circuit with applications. In boolean algebra calculator circuit, we use boolean algebra simplification methods like the quinemccluskey algorithm to simplify the boolean expression and display the output on the display. Formal verification based on boolean expression diagrams. According to electronics project designs project website, it is even possible to use the technology of fm radio to have students make their own walkietalkies and portable home phone units. In this project, the power supply is about 5v, and it is given to the microcontroller, keypad and display. The specific gate operation is attained by using diodes or transistors that acts like a switch 0 is off 0 volt and 1 is on 5 volt. It is an arithmetic interpretation of proposition logic and is also similar to set theory. Above figure shows the basic block diagram of the project.
Boolean algebra was invented by george boole in 1854. It is a method of representing expressions using only two values true and false typically and was first proposed by george boole in 1847. The operation of this boolean algebra simplifier calculator consists of different blocks such as power supply, microcontroller, led display and keypad. It takes the min terms of the boolean expression as inputs and displays the. Truth tables and boolean algebra university of plymouth. In the midtwentieth century, this special twovalued arithmetical algebra became important in the application of boolean algebra to the design of circuits3. In our circuit, we use boolean algebra simplification methods like the quinemccluskey algorithm to simplify the boolean expression and. It is used to analyze and simplify digital circuits.
Famous for the numbertheoretic firstorder statement known as goodsteins theorem, author r. The dual can be found by interchanging the and and or operators. Variables are case sensitive, can be longer than a single character, can only contain alphanumeric characters, digits and the underscore. Circuit simplification examples boolean algebra electronics.